Основы Java и Программирование
Курс начинается с изучения основ Java, включая синтаксис языка, основы ООП (объектно-ориентированное программирование), исключения, потоки ввода-вывода и коллекции. Эти знания создают фундамент для понимания более сложных концепций, которые будут изучены на более поздних этапах курса.
Продвинутые Темы и Разработка Приложений
Углубившись в Java, курс охватывает продвинутые темы, такие как многопоточность, работы с сетями, графический пользовательский интерфейс (GUI), и веб-разработка с использованием Java. Учащиеся узнают, как разрабатывать сложные приложения, включая клиент-серверные приложения и веб-сервисы.
Современные Подходы и Реальные Проекты
Курс также включает современные подходы в разработке, такие как Agile и TDD (Test-Driven Development). Учащиеся будут работать над реальными проектами, что позволит им применять полученные знания в практическом контексте, а также развивать навыки решения реальных задач в области программирования.